New York Fashion Week marks the official start of the season, and cold weather is no match for fashion’s faithful, especially the celebrities holding court in the front row. Tove Lo, the Swedish-born electropop superstar, braved the snow and slush to touch down in the Big Apple for the Fall 2026 runway shows and presentations. From Collina Strada, Jane Wade, and AREA to a late-night pit stop at Brooklyn’s underground techno haven, Basement, she took us along for the ride during her whirlwind week.

Below, Tove Lo takes V inside the magic of Fashion Week through the eyes of one of pop’s coolest stars.
